Annual Study Organizer Order Tracker – Excel Template Description

Study Organizer, Order Tracker, Annual: This comprehensive Excel template is meticulously designed to support academic professionals, students, and educational institutions in organizing their annual study plans while simultaneously tracking the procurement and delivery of essential learning materials. The combination of an Annual timeline with a structured Order Tracker system makes this template ideal for managing course-related supplies, textbooks, digital subscriptions, software licenses, lab equipment, and other educational resources in a centralized and visual manner.

SHEET NAMES AND STRUCTURE

The template consists of five primary sheets that work cohesively:
  1. Dashboard (Overview): A dynamic summary view providing real-time insights into order status, budget utilization, and timeline progress across the academic year.
  2. Order Tracking List: The core data table where all orders are recorded with full details including item description, quantity, cost, delivery date, and status.
  3. Annual Study Plan Calendar: A visual calendar layout mapping study milestones (exams, project deadlines) against the order delivery schedule.
  4. Budget Tracker: A financial management sheet to allocate and monitor spending per category across the year.
  5. Reference & Guidelines: Contains instructions, definitions, formulas explanation, and template usage tips for first-time users.

TABLE STRUCTURE AND COLUMNS (Order Tracking List)

The main data sheet—Order Tracking List—follows a well-structured table with the following columns and data types:
Column Name Data Type Description / Notes
Order ID (Unique) Text (Auto-generated) A unique 6-digit alphanumeric code (e.g., STU2024-001) to identify each order. Auto-filled using a formula.
Item Description Text Name of the study material (e.g., "Advanced Calculus Textbook," "Lab Kit for Biochemistry").
Category Dropdown List (Validation) Options: Textbooks, Software, Lab Equipment, Digital Subscriptions, Stationery, Other.
Quantity Numeric (Whole Number) Number of units ordered.
Unit Cost ($) Numeric (Currency Format) Cost per unit in USD.
Total Cost ($) Numeric (Formula-Based, Currency Format) Automatically calculated as: Quantity × Unit Cost.
Order Date Date (MM/DD/YYYY) Date the order was placed.
Expected Delivery Date Date (MM/DD/YYYY) Planned delivery date from vendor.
Actual Delivery Date Date (MM/DD/YYYY) Leave blank until item is received. Used for tracking delays.
Status Dropdown (Pending, In Transit, Delivered, Delayed, Cancelled) Real-time status update based on delivery progress.
Notes Text Add comments such as "Requires approval from department head" or "Rushed shipping requested."

FORMULAS REQUIRED FOR AUTOMATION AND CALCULATION

This template leverages several formulas to automate tracking and enhance functionality:
  • Order ID Generation: =TEXT(TODAY(),"YY")&"-"&TEXT(ROW()-1,"000") — This formula ensures unique IDs based on year and row number.
  • Total Cost Calculation: =C2*D2 (in Total Cost column).
  • Status Update Logic: Conditional formulas to flag delays. For example: =IF(AND(E2="",F2<>"",F2"", "Delivered", IF(F2="", "Pending", "In Transit")))
  • Days to Delivery: =IF(F2<>"", F2-TODAY(), "") — Shows how many days remain until expected delivery.
  • Budget Summary (Dashboard): Use SUMIFS(), COUNTIFS(), and AVERAGEIF() to aggregate costs and statuses by category or month.

CONDITIONAL FORMATTING RULES

To enhance visual clarity, the template includes these conditional formatting rules:
  • Status Highlighting: Color-code cells based on status — red for "Delayed," yellow for "In Transit," green for "Delivered."
  • Delivery Alerts: Highlight rows where Expected Delivery Date is within 7 days (using formula: =F2-TODAY()<=7).
  • Budget Thresholds: Use data bars and color scales in the Budget Tracker sheet to show spending levels against allocated limits.

USER INSTRUCTIONS FOR EFFECTIVE USE

  1. Open the template and save it with a personalized filename (e.g., "Annual Study Organizer - 2024-2025").
  2. Navigate to the Order Tracking List. Enter new orders in sequential rows starting from Row 3.
  3. Use the dropdown menus for Category and Status to maintain consistency.
  4. Update Actual Delivery Date when items arrive — this triggers status updates and delay alerts.
  5. Regularly review the Dashboard to monitor budget, order progress, and upcoming deadlines.
  6. In the Annual Study Plan Calendar, link each study milestone (exam dates, project submissions) with relevant order delivery timelines for seamless planning.
  7. Use the Budget Tracker to allocate funds monthly and track spending. Set up alerts when exceeding 80% of budget per category.

RECOMMENDED CHARTS AND DASHBOARDS

The Dashboard (Overview) sheet should include:
  • Pie Chart: Percentage distribution of total spending by category.
  • Bar Chart: Monthly order volume and budget allocation vs. actual spend.
  • Gantt-style Timeline: Visual representation of order placement, delivery expectations, and study milestones across the year (using conditional formatting or a custom chart).
  • Status Heatmap: A color-coded grid showing number of orders per status by month.
